Age | Commit message (Collapse) | Author | |
---|---|---|---|
2002-11-01 | Make uncompress a seperate applet so it doesnt pull in all the gunzip code | Glenn L McGrath | |
2002-11-01 | Allow short reads when filling compress buffer | Glenn L McGrath | |
2002-11-01 | Make it a fatal error if bad chksum or crc, if not we should return an error ↵ | Glenn L McGrath | |
code | |||
2002-10-22 | Move unzip.c uncompress.c from libbb to archiveal/libunarchive | Glenn L McGrath | |
2002-10-19 | Update dpkg to use new unarchive code | Glenn L McGrath | |
2002-10-19 | Fix exclude/include problem | Glenn L McGrath | |
2002-10-19 | Find a string in a list | Glenn L McGrath | |
2002-10-19 | Remove entries from the accept list as they are matched so we can determine ↵ | Glenn L McGrath | |
if any files that were specified in the list wernt found. | |||
2002-10-10 | last_patch61 from vodz: | Eric Andersen | |
New complex patch for decrease size devel version. Requires previous patch. Also removed small problems from dutmp and tar applets. Also includes vodz' last_patch61_2: Last patch correcting comment for #endif and more integrated with libbb (very reduce size if used "cat" applet also). Requires last_patch61 for modutils/config.in. | |||
2002-09-30 | Patch from Konstantin Isakov <ikm@pisem.net>: | Eric Andersen | |
In most cases, dirname returns the same argument it was given, so this code works nice, but there's one special case: when the name contains no dirname, it returns "." (stored statically in the body of itself), and we get a segfault in attempt to free() it. This patch fixes this problem. | |||
2002-09-27 | Fix compress support and prevent a segfault | Glenn L McGrath | |
2002-09-25 | Remove files made obsolete by new unarchiving code | Glenn L McGrath | |
2002-09-25 | New common unarchive code. | Glenn L McGrath | |
2002-09-17 | Modified so that it "works" for archs other than i386... arm in particular. | Manuel Novoa III | |
Also tried to clean up the logic a little, and ensure that read errors or invalid archives resulted in error returns. This could use a lot more work... Volunteers? | |||
2002-09-16 | Patch from Matthias Lang <matthias@corelatus.se> to fix gunzip | Eric Andersen | |
error handling and prevent gunzip from hanging. | |||
2002-09-15 | Support for GNU style long filename and linknames | Glenn L McGrath | |
2002-08-22 | replace some global const ints with defines | Glenn L McGrath | |
2002-08-22 | Specify cast | Glenn L McGrath | |
2002-08-22 | Run through indent, fix comments | Glenn L McGrath | |
2002-08-22 | Run through ident, fix comments | Glenn L McGrath | |
2002-08-22 | Honour the USTAR prefix field, this enables a 155 byte path length plus the ↵ | Glenn L McGrath | |
normal 100 byte filename. The catch is gnu tar cannot create archives that use the prefix field, you need to use s-tar. | |||
2002-08-13 | Enable support for the old tar header format, enable via menu's | Glenn L McGrath | |
2002-07-19 | Applied vodz' patches #49 and #50 (with a small correction in runshell.c) | Robert Griebl | |
#49: I found one memory overflow and memory leak in "ln" applet. Last patch reduced also 54 bytes. ;) #50: I found bug in loginutils/Makefile.in. New patch have also new function to libbb and aplied this to applets and other cosmetic changes. | |||
2002-07-11 | Fixup warnings and undefined operations that show up in gcc-3.1 | Eric Andersen | |
-Erik | |||
2002-05-29 | Patch from Randolfe Averty to fixup package conflict checks, cleanup some ↵ | Glenn L McGrath | |
memory leaks and reorganise dependency checking. Some further memory leaks fixed by me. | |||
2002-05-19 | Support old-style compress (.Z) files via libbb / unzip( ) calls | Robert Griebl | |
(configurable) - When enabled an applet "uncompress" is also made available (oddname to gunzip) [the cvs add for this file got lost somehow...] | |||
2002-05-15 | Support old-style compress (.Z) files via libbb / unzip( ) calls | Robert Griebl | |
(configurable) - When enabled an applet "uncompress" is also made available (oddname to gunzip) | |||
2002-04-13 | Patch from Laurence Anderson <L.D.Anderson@warwick.ac.uk> for | Eric Andersen | |
better tape drive support in tar/cpio by using an intervening pipe... | |||
2002-04-12 | Completely rework the config system so that it no longer annoys me to work on | Eric Andersen | |
the busybox development tree. This eliminates the use of recursive make, and once again allows us to run 'make' in a subdirectory with the expected result. And things are now much faster too. Greatly improved IMHO... -Erik | |||
2002-03-20 | Reinitialize initial shift register value for on each pass. | Eric Andersen | |
-Erik | |||
2002-01-02 | unzip applet by Laurence Anderson | Glenn L McGrath | |
---------------------------------------------------------------------- | |||
2001-12-20 | Remove `== TRUE' tests and convert `!= TRUE' and `== FALSE' tests to use !. | Matt Kraai | |
2001-12-06 | More copyright and email addr cleanups | Eric Andersen | |
2001-12-06 | Commit my improvement on Rodney Brown's patch to g(un)zip, decreasing | Aaron Lehmann | |
binary size. | |||
2001-12-05 | Simplify unzip(), remove unused checks and unneccessary variables | Glenn L McGrath | |
2001-12-05 | Simplify CRC table generation | Glenn L McGrath | |
2001-11-29 | gunzip was incorrectly reporting a failed crc and length (discovered by | Glenn L McGrath | |
Chang, Shu-Hao). The bitbuffer needs to be unwound after decompression, as it was eating into the crc/size field. | |||
2001-10-27 | Attempt to fix libc compiling error regarding off_t | Glenn L McGrath | |
2001-10-25 | *** empty log message *** | Glenn L McGrath | |
2001-10-18 | Scrub up some function prototypes. | Eric Andersen | |
-Erik | |||
2001-07-17 | This is vodz' latest patch. Sorry it took so long... | Eric Andersen | |
1) ping cleanup (compile fix from this patch already applied). 2) traceroute call not spare ntohl() now (and reduce size); 3) Fix for functions not declared static in insmod, ash, vi and mount. 4) a more simple API cmdedit :)) 5) adds "stopped jobs" warning to ash on Ctrl-D and fixes "ignoreeof" option 6) reduce exporting library function index->strchr (traceroute), bzero->memset (syslogd) | |||
2001-07-13 | Dont setvbuff in here, must be called just after stream is initialised, ↵ | Glenn L McGrath | |
glibc tolerates using it later, uclibc doesnt | |||
2001-07-11 | free coniditionally, just to make it play nice with dmalloc which is ↵ | Glenn L McGrath | |
incompatable with standard free() | |||
2001-06-29 | Add some missing includes to kill warnings when building with the default | Manuel Novoa III | |
Config.h and using gcc's -fno-builtin. There are probably other files with the similar problems. Also, if building against uClibc, don't include asm/unistd.h in syscalls.c and module_syscalls.c. | |||
2001-06-27 | Fix a type promotion bug discivered and analyzed by Alan Modra | Eric Andersen | |
<amodra@bigpond.net.au>, which caused false checksum errors | |||
2001-04-25 | Move messages.c to libbb. Make each string in messages.c be its own .o file. | Eric Andersen | |
This way, we can new get rid of all that tedious #define rubbish we used to need to enable specific messages. This way is enormously simpler, and as a bonus also ends up saving us 96 bytes. -Erik | |||
2001-04-18 | Eliminated seeks so that we work correctly on pipes, and removed reliance on | Matt Kraai | |
undefined evaluation ordering. Thanks to Anthony Towns for explanation and solution. | |||
2001-04-11 | Disable sigterm | Glenn L McGrath | |
2001-04-11 | Move unzip, gz_open, gz_close to libbb | Glenn L McGrath | |